The Czech koruna closes today session at 28,23 Kč/EUR, flat from yesterday. The trading was quiet even after today events. Neither the Czech central bank nor the ECB surprised, the rates in the CR and eurozone stayed on hold as expected. Following statements were also in line with previous expectations on future interest rates paths, so the overal influence on the FX market was modest. The CZK slightly reacted on the HUF weakening before the end of the day, but didn´t go down significantly.
The CZK has lost against the US dollar as the American currency is gaining versus the euro. The Trichet´s speech helped the euro to go a bit stronger, but following US data were in overal better than expected and improved mood on the USD before tomorrow payrolls. The USD/EUR rate now stands at the 1,2800 level.
